Unique Odor Control Science for RV Tanks
RV holding tanks are essentially mini-sewage treatment plants that rely on either chemical or biological processes to break down waste. Chemical treatments work by masking odors with heavy perfumes or by using biocides to kill the bacteria that produce foul-smelling gases. This is effective for short-term odor suppression, but it can be harsh on plumbing seals and the environment.
Biological or enzyme-based treatments take a different approach by introducing beneficial bacteria that "eat" the waste and toilet paper. These treatments are generally safer for the environment and prevent the buildup of sludge that can clog sensors. However, they require a bit more patience, as they take time to colonize the tank and start the digestion process.

Proper Dosing Methods for Tank Chemicals
The most common mistake I see is under-dosing, especially in hot weather or when the tank is near capacity. Always add your treatment with a gallon or two of water immediately after dumping the tank to ensure the product can circulate. Without that initial "water bed," the chemicals or enzymes will just sit at the bottom and fail to coat the tank surfaces.
- Follow the label: Do not guess the dosage; over-dosing can be just as problematic as under-dosing.
- Temperature matters: In extreme heat, you may need to increase the dosage slightly to keep up with faster bacterial growth.
- Water volume: Never dump chemicals into a bone-dry tank; they need water to activate and distribute.
Managing Ventilation for Odor Prevention
Even the best chemicals cannot overcome poor ventilation. Most RV tanks have a roof vent designed to pull gases out through the top of the vehicle, but these can become blocked by debris or insect nests. If you notice odors inside the bathroom, check your roof vent cap first to ensure it is clear and allowing proper airflow.
Additionally, consider installing a 360-degree vent cap or a powered vent fan to create a vacuum effect that pulls odors up and out. This simple mechanical upgrade often works better than any chemical treatment alone. If your bathroom lacks a dedicated fan, keeping a small window cracked while flushing can also help prevent odors from lingering in the living space.
Routine Tank Cleaning and Maintenance Tips
Maintenance is the difference between a system that lasts ten years and one that needs replacing after two. Periodically perform a "deep clean" by filling your tank halfway with water and a specialized tank cleaner, then driving to your next destination to let the sloshing action scrub the walls. This removes stubborn deposits that harbor bacteria and cause recurring smells.
Never leave your black tank valve open while connected to a sewer hookup, as this allows liquids to drain while leaving solids behind to create a "poop pyramid." Always wait until the tank is at least 3/4 full before dumping to ensure there is enough pressure to flush everything out. These small, disciplined habits will save you from major plumbing headaches down the road.
